I found a great alternative commute route, too. From Queen/Roncesvalles to Sheppard/Leslie I used to take Lansdowne->Dupont->Avenue Rd->Kilbarry->Lascelles (Park) -> Chaplin -> Duplex -> Fairlawn -> Yonge ->Sheppard, which is a fine route excepting the awful hill down and then up again at Yonge/York Mills-401.

My alternative is skipping Yonge totally and only going up as far as Montgomery (Broadway) on Duplex and then across to Bayview, then take that north. I've done the reverse trip this way and it was pretty decent.

It's been averaging about an hour/1:15 depending on wind/tiredness on the old route so I guess I'll see how it goes.
